CALVADOS - NEAR CREVECOEUR-EN-AUGE 25 mn from the sea, in the heart of the Pays d'Auge famous for its charm and serenity, at the end of the driveway you'll find this original 16th-century brick manor house, restored in the 19th century to its authentic architectural style and surrounded by 16.9 hectares. The 250 sqm dwelling features a beautiful living room with parquet floor and fireplace, a dining room and a superb living room with stone fireplace, complemented by a fitted kitchen, a scullery and the laundry room hiding the cumulus and heat pump. Upstairs, four bedrooms and two shower rooms in a charming setting of half-timbered walls. A traditional square courtyard adjoins the house, with two adjoining outbuildings and a shed for a possible project with thirteen stables and a former trotting track. In one of the buildings, a renovated 85 sqm dwelling with a large 42 sqm living room, two bedrooms and a shower room in perfect condition. The exceptional environment of grasslands and woods preserves this beautiful property. Less than two hours from Paris. In the heart of the Pays d'Auge, 20 minutes from the sea and 2h15 from Paris, a few minutes from Beuvron-en-Auge ranked among the most beautiful villages in France, a Renaissance manor from the 16th century listed on the Supplementary Inventory of Historic Monuments (ISMH). Built in Caen stone and covered with slate, it offers approximately 380 sqm of living space over three levels. The main façade, rhythmically punctuated by its regular bays and sculpted dormer windows, features typical Calvados Renaissance architecture. The main staircase in stone and solid wood is a major feature of the manor. It serves the three levels and demonstrates the original quality of construction. All furniture has been selected to blend in with the old structure and enhance the volumes. On the ground floor: central entrance with period staircase, large corner lounge with monumental fireplace, dining room for twelve guests and a fully equipped kitchen with central island. On the first floor: main suite with bedroom, boudoir, dressing room and bathroom; second suite with private water room; third bedroom and independent bathroom. On the second floor: fourth bedroom, water room and room under the rafters. Full basement with cellar, boiler room and storage. The approximately 8,000 sqm land includes landscaped park, orchard and a stone shed used as a storage room. The property borders a river and benefits from a quiet environment, close to shops and services. Manor delivered with all furniture. Historic Monument enjoying tax advantages: deduction of expenses from taxable income (or 50% of expenses if no visit) and exemption from inheritance tax if kept for 15 years by heirs. In NORMANDY, in the Pays d'Auge of CALVADOS and near LISIEUX (14100), the AGENCY TERRES ET DEMEURES DE NORMANDIE in LISIEUX 14100 - 41 Avenue Victor HUGO, offers this exceptional property exclusively for horse breeding. Situated in a preserved landscaped setting and surrounded by prestigious breeding stud farms, it comprises buildings dating from the 15th and 16th centuries, along with modern and functional agricultural buildings for horse breeding, all set within a total of 48 hectares of good-quality land. The buildings are as follows: A Norman manor partly dating from the 15th and 16th centuries: stone and half-timbered construction, under tile roofing, arranged as follows: Ground floor: an entrance, a cloakroom and a WC with a washbasin. To the right of the entrance: a living room with a dining area and lounge in front of a large fireplace, and a kitchenette, a lounge with a fireplace (tiles and exposed stones). To the left, a kitchen, a dining room, and a staircase leading to two bedrooms. First Floor: Access via staircase No. 1: two bedrooms and a shower room (shower) – Access via the wooden staircase No. 2 from the 15th century: one bedroom with a fireplace (tiles), one bedroom with tiles (augé pavers), a bathroom (bathtub and WC), two bedrooms in a row. Second Floor: a large study. Adjacent to the Manor: a cellar with the heat pump, a room with 2 showers, a WC, a washbasin, a porch, and a workshop. An old bread oven converted into rural lodging with half-timbered construction and tile roofing includes: a living area, a kitchenette, a bedroom and an alcove, a bathroom (bathtub and WC). Surrounding the Manor, a private access road paved and stoned, a courtyard, lawn, 2 ponds fed by a stream, a spring. A set of agricultural buildings for the breeding of horses and cattle: Half-timbered building comprising: 3 large boxes, at the back 5 boxes constructed of concrete blocks. Building constructed of concrete and blocks, wooden structure, fiber-cement sheet roofing includes: 6 solid boxes, 3 boxes with removable walls, a care box with gynecological bar, a part for storing fodder and agricultural equipment, 4 stabling areas. Adjacent a lean-to with agricultural equipment, two boxes constructed of concrete blocks. A building constructed of half-timbering and tile roofing: 2 boxes, an old stable, 2 rooms (bedrooms), large attic above. A building constructed of concrete and blocks, wooden structure, with fiber cement sheet roofing: 11 boxes, an old dairy, a part for stabling, a holding pen, 4 large boxes for foaling mares. Nearby a pasture for cattle. All on an area of about 48 hectares in one single block, distributed as follows: Fields used for grazing, enclosed by rails and strands, served by stoned paths, arranged in paddocks and supplied with water through automatic drinkers. Woodland (about 3 hectares). Located in a beautiful setting and immediately near large horse breeding stud farms, this well-structured property with both old and modern buildings will suit all horse breeders (amateurs or professionals) and can adapt to any type of horse breeding.
